Output 7d32f706970a4568f24f6d4f474bcc47b25cf941a8b14b56b3eac5d4ac25d96a:27

value
182646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ac7202710a8f605edeb4f2c904cec95756e56b42 OP_EQUAL
address
3HQpj4SV4EVgZkykoRT7TKGxAkFthFK35t
transaction
7d32f706970a4568f24f6d4f474bcc47b25cf941a8b14b56b3eac5d4ac25d96a
confirmations
116574
spent
true